11:41 a.m. UPDATE: All lanes have reopened following a semi-truck crash that shut down I-10 in both directions near mile marker 338 for hours.
According to Dylan Bryan of Florida Highway Patrol, one person was airlifted to a nearby hospital with non-life threatening injuries.
The Florida Department of Transportation says the crash involves three tractor trailers.
There is a crash with injuries on I-10 eastbound at mile marker 338, according to the Florida Highway Patrol.
Authorities said all lanes eastbound and westbound are closed at this time.
A life flight helicopter has been requested, FDOT said.
